Going Out: The Optimo (Espacio) Barrowland Revue

Image
This weekend Optimo (Espacio) working along with The East End Social bring a great show to the Barrowland Ballroom. Starting at 5pm the stellar line up includes the Scottish debut from Norwegian electro DJ Todd Terje and a full live set from Golden Teacher . Between this there will be DJ sets from Glasgow's own Optimo, Hessle Audio's Ben UFO and Beats in Space DJ Tim Sweeney . This great lineup will be followed by an afterparty at Sub Club from 11 with subbie veterans Twitch & Wilkes along with special guests. Going Out - Todd Terje

Image
This Saturday Glasgow's Sub Club plays host to Norway's disco prince Todd Terje alongside residents Harri and Dom for Subculture. Be prepared for a touch of everything from his own personal edits and upfront gems that will have everyone getting down. He's known for all ways bringing a good vibe with a great selection and this is not likely to be any different. With a strong influence from his older Norwegian counterparts Lindstrom  and Prins Thomas, Todd Terje has been an excitiing prospect with the release of excellently crafted disco/house tracks such as Eurodans and Ragysh and is know for his own personal edits ranging from Roxy Music to Diana Ross to Adam Ant. Music Monday - Todd Terje

Image
You may have already heard of "Todd Terje" if not you will soon with the release of his infectious "Inspector Norse" single, which is looking to be one of the catchiest, exciting and probably one of the most simple dance tracks of the summer if not the year. The video for it is pretty funny too, keep your eyes peeled for the full short movie version to be released pretty soon. Originally from Norway Todd Terje is a DJ/Producer who would be placed in the Nu-Disco genre. He started to build a large undergound following after he put out early re-edits and his debut single Euro dans, which has summer written all over. He's got one hell of a tache an all. The Norwegian based DJ/Producer who studied Physics at Oslo University is likely to have been influenced by fellow Norwegians Lindstrom and Prins Tomas, in creating modern disco and some really excellent re-edits of old disco classics such as Chic - I want your love.
